Tight finances hinder parish
by Michael DeVault - posted E-mail Story E-mail Story | Print Story Print Story 
The Ouachita Parish Police Jury anticipates posting "modest budget deficit" in its general fund in 2012, according to outgoing Police Juror Charles Jackson.

That revelation surfaced in spite media reports that the Police Jury was poised to approve a more than $60-million budget for the 2012 fiscal year that included a small surplus.

The Police Jury is expected to approve the 2012 budget at a regular meeting Monday, Dec. 19.

"The general fund will be budgeted with a modest deficit," said Jackson, who serves as the Police Jury's finance committee chairman.
